The cheapest way to get from Salavas to Privas is to bus which costs €9 - €12 and takes 2h 34m.
The fastest way to get from Salavas to Privas is to drive which takes 56 min and costs €8 - €13.
No, there is no direct bus from Salavas to Privas. However, there are services departing from Village and arriving at Privas Cours Du Palais via Aubenas Place De La Paix.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 34m.
The distance between Salavas and Privas is 68 km. The road distance is 56.4 km.
The best way to get from Salavas to Privas without a car is to bus which takes 2h 34m and costs €9 - €12.
It takes approximately 2h 34m to get from Salavas to Privas, including transfers.
